Basic information of OP37EZ amplifier:

OP37EZ is an OPERATIONAL AMPLIFIER. Commonly used packaging methods are DIP, DIP8,.3

OP37EZ amplifier core information:

The minimum operating temperature of OP37EZ is -25 °C and the maximum operating temperature is 85 °C. Maximum bias current at 25°C: 0.04 µA Maximum average bias current is 0.04 µA

How to simply check the efficiency of an amplifier? Looking at its slew rate, the OP37EZ has a nominal slew rate of 17 V/us. The minimum slew rate of OP37EZ given by the manufacturer is 11 V/us. Its minimum voltage gain is 800000. When the op amp is used in closed loop, at a certain closed-loop gain (usually 1 or 2, 10, etc.), the frequency when the OP37EZ gain becomes 0.707 times the low-frequency gain is 63000 kHz.

The nominal supply voltage of OP37EZ is 15 V, and its corresponding nominal negative supply voltage is -15 V. The input offset voltage of OP37EZ is 50 µV (input offset voltage: the compensation voltage added between the two input terminals to make the output terminal of the operational amplifier 0V (or close to 0V).)

Related dimensions of OP37EZ:

OP37EZ has 8 terminals. Its terminal position type is: DUAL. Terminal pitch is 2.54 mm. Total pins: 8

OP37EZ amplifier additional information:

OP37EZ adopts the VOLTAGE-FEEDBACK architecture. It belongs to the low offset class of amplifiers. The frequency compensation status of OP37EZ is: YES (AVCL>=5). Its temperature grade is: OTHER. OP37EZ is not Rohs certified.

The corresponding JESD-30 code is: R-CDIP-T8. The packaging code of OP37EZ is: DIP. OP37EZ packaging materials are mostly CERAMIC, METAL-SEALED COFIRED. The package shape is RECTANGULAR. OP37EZ package pin formats are: IN-LINE.

Its terminal form is: THROUGH-HOLE.
